Cento Brand Guide

Cento stands out in the world of Italian grocery essentials, offering pantry staples that capture the true essence of Italy. Known for their marinara sauces and high-quality peeled tomatoes, Cento products are favorites among home cooks who crave restaurant-quality flavors without leaving the kitchen.

Why Choose Cento for Your Italian Cooking Needs

Cento focuses on sourcing the finest ingredients from Italy, ensuring every jar and can delivers exceptional taste and texture. Their lineup emphasizes traditional recipes and superior quality, making them a go-to for pasta lovers, pizza makers, and anyone building a well-stocked pantry. What sets Cento apart is their commitment to authenticity—products like their marinara pasta sauce and whole peeled tomatoes are crafted to highlight natural flavors, with minimal additives to let the ingredients shine.

In the realm of Marinara Sauces, Cento excels by blending ripe tomatoes with herbs and spices in time-honored ways. These sauces serve as versatile bases for spaghetti, lasagna, or even as a dipping companion. Similarly, their peeled tomatoes provide a canvas for custom sauces, stews, and soups, prized for their plump texture and rich puree.

Product Quality and Standout Features

Cento’s reputation rests on rigorous selection and processing standards. Their certified San Marzano whole peeled tomatoes, for instance, are grown and packed in Italy, arriving in thick puree with a touch of basil for added aroma. This attention to detail ensures consistent performance in recipes, whether you're simmering a slow-cooked ragu or whipping up a quick weeknight meal.

The brand’s marinara sauce embodies simplicity and depth, using high-quality tomatoes that yield a smooth, vibrant finish. Free from unnecessary preservatives, these products appeal to those seeking clean-label options without sacrificing bold Italian character. Cento’s packaging also preserves freshness, making them reliable shelf staples.
